Abstract

Steganography is defined as the study of invisible communication. Steganography usually deals with the ways of hiding the existence of the communicated data in such a way that it remains confidential. Steganography is the technique of hiding private or sensitive information within something that appears to be nothing out of the usual. Steganography is often confused with cryptology because the two are similar in the way that they both are used to protect important information. It maintains secrecy between two communicating parties. In image steganography, secrecy is achieved by embedding data into cover image and generating a stego-image. There are different types of steganography techniques each have their strengths and weaknesses. In the Steganography is secret writing or hiding fact that communication taking place, by hiding secret information inside image. The scope of project is implementation of steganography tools for information includes any type of information file and image file and path where user want to retrieve the information file. For hiding information in image, their exist large variety of steganography techniques some are more complex than others and all of them have respective strong and weak points
